Job description

Reliability Engineer (Vibration Analysis / Condition Monitoring)
Salary: Basic from £40,000 + Benefits
Location: Sellafield, Cumbria


A large Blue-Chip organisation is currently looking for a Reliability Engineer to be based at a client site in Cumbria. The Reliability Engineer will be required to complete Predictive Maintenance, Condition Based Maintenance, and Root Cause Analysis techniques to maximise plant reliability, acting as a specialist consultant at the site.


Skills required for a Reliability Engineer:
  1. The ideal candidate will hold a Mechanical or Electrical Engineering Qualification.
  2. A background in mining, marine, rail, nuclear, manufacturing, or chemical would be advantageous.
  3. Experience in the use of CBM hardware and software from: Emerson, SKF, PRUFTECHNIK, SPM, Fluke, Flir, SDT, Commtest/Bentley Nevada/GE.
  4. Ideally have a Level 1 or Level 2 Vibration Analysis qualification.
  5. Prepared to work throughout the Home Counties Area and very occasional travel into London.
  6. Full UK Driving Licence.
  7. Live within commutable distance to the client site in the Cumbria area.
